Our St. George field technicians perform forensic photo-audits on every project. This means we don't just look at the shingles; we inspect the decking integrity, the ventilation net-free-area, and the flashing transitions at chimneys and skylights. This depth of analysis ensures that yourroof replacement solution is built for the long-term, not just a quick aesthetic fix.

St. George roofs suffer primarily from UV bake-off. Shingles can become brittle in half the time compared to Northern Utah if not properly ventilated.
